Legal Secretary

Bristol

Up to £28k p.a

Our client, one of the top law firms in the UK is looking for a Legal Secretary to join their team.

The role:

  • To provide a full legal secretarial service to include pro-active diary management, producing letters and documents utilising the Case Management and IT systems as appropriate, ensuring the highest levels of speed, accuracy, presentation & confidentiality.
  • Responsible for document production, formatting, proof reading and correcting, ensuring consistency.
  • Support Fee Earners to deliver a client focused service through telephone calls and emails to clients and third parties, following up and chasing open issues.
  • File management; to manage the filing system, including electronic file management on the IT systems, following correct procedures to aid rapid retrieval and provide an effective source of information. Also photocopying appropriate documents, and setting up and archiving files.
  • To respond quickly and efficiently to clients whether through telephone calls or face to face, ensuring that an appropriate answer is given or an accurate message is taken and passed to the relevant member of the team for action.
  • Assisting with the coordination of internal and business development events, making available marketing literature, sending out invitations, liaising with external contacts, booking venues and catering where required.
  • To prepare and complete all necessary forms relevant to the team delegated by the Fee Earner, ensuring the highest levels of accuracy, including Know Your Client procedures and file opening.
  • To complete transfers, under instructions from a Fee Earner, of disbursements and monies on client accounts, using account office printouts, to ensure accurate settlement of both client and Firm accounts.
  • To produce draft bills using the accounts system, time breakdowns, bills that have been drawn up by the Fee Earner, ensuring the highest levels of accuracy and presentation according to clients’ individual needs.
  • Monitor the daily email, voicemail and post for the Fee Earners (where applicable) and seek advice from colleagues in responding to urgent correspondence to ensure that client needs are met as part of the Firms' professional service. Sending emails on Fee Earners behalf where appropriate.
  • Support the Fee Earners in client relationships, getting to know key clients, maintaining accurate data (addresses, contacts, CRM) and providing regular reporting to clients as agreed as part of service levels. Liaising with Partners and Fee Earners on outstanding projects.
  • Taking minutes at internal meetings, follow up on actions, distributing minutes.

Key skills/ experience:

  • Previous experience of professional services within a law firm
  • Strong communicator with excellent interpersonal skills.
  • Exceptional understanding of confidentiality.
  • High standards of client service.
  • Ability to deal with high volume workload, with a high level of accuracy.
  • Excellent user of MS Office including Outlook, Word, Excel, PowerPoint
